Artificial Intelligence (AI) is revolutionizing various sectors, and cybersecurity is no exception. With the increasing volume of data and the sophistication of cyber threats, AI presents innovative solutions for data protection.
One of the most significant advantages of AI in cybersecurity is its ability to analyze vast amounts of data to detect threats in real time. Machine learning algorithms can identify patterns and anomalies that humans might overlook, enabling quicker responses to potential security breaches.
AI can automate responses to certain types of incidents, allowing organizations to react swiftly to threats. For example, if abnormal activity is detected, AI systems can automatically isolate affected systems, preventing further damage.
AI-based tools can streamline authentication processes, reducing the risk of unauthorized access. By analyzing user behavior, these tools can detect unusual activities that may indicate a security breach.
AI empowers organizations to adopt a proactive approach to cybersecurity. Predictive analytics can forecast potential attack vectors, helping organizations strengthen their defenses before an attack occurs.
While AI presents numerous benefits, implementing these technologies also comes with challenges. Organizations must ensure that AI systems are trained on accurate and diverse datasets to avoid biases. Moreover, the reliance on AI can lead to complacency in manual cybersecurity efforts.
As cyber threats become more complex, leveraging AI for data protection is no longer optional but essential. By integrating AI into cybersecurity strategies, organizations can enhance their defense mechanisms and protect sensitive data more effectively.
